Transaction 141902489035c45614288db4e46b601149b9b3fa41fb57cf0867767c5a1332c9
1 Input
2 Outputs
- 141902489035c45614288db4e46b601149b9b3fa41fb57cf0867767c5a1332c9:0
- 141902489035c45614288db4e46b601149b9b3fa41fb57cf0867767c5a1332c9:1
value 24646793
address 15Zs7B6p8Zn7sWHbetfc7H5eTTfqofEWz8
value 3490852
address 1AHHPswaQvNsUGtzXmJyLucnv7kr58rm2M